Overview

The high-efficiency flake ice machine is a specialized refrigeration unit that generates thin, dry flake ice, ideal for industrial cooling applications. Unlike cube or block ice, flake ice has a larger surface area, enabling faster heat transfer. These machines are widely adopted in food processing plants, fisheries, and chemical facilities due to their reliability and energy-saving design. Modern flake ice machines incorporate advanced compressors and evaporators to optimize performance. They are designed for continuous operation, with some models capable of producing several tons of ice per day. The ice produced is typically around 1.5–2.5 mm thick, making it suitable for direct contact with products like seafood or bakery items.

Structure and Working Principle

A flake ice machine consists of a refrigeration system, water distribution system, ice-making evaporator, and harvesting mechanism. The evaporator is a vertical cylinder with a spiral groove inner wall. Water is pumped over the evaporator surface, where it freezes into a thin layer. A rotating blade scrapes the ice off, creating flakes that fall into a storage bin. The refrigeration cycle uses eco-friendly refrigerants like R404A or R507. Key components include the compressor, condenser, and expansion valve, which work together to maintain efficient heat exchange. Advanced models feature PLC controls for automated operation and real-time monitoring of ice production and system health.

Key Features

Energy efficiency is a hallmark of high-performance flake ice machines, with some models achieving COP (Coefficient of Performance) values above 3.0. They often include frequency conversion technology to adjust compressor speed based on demand, reducing power consumption by up to 30% compared to conventional units. Durability is ensured through corrosion-resistant materials, such as stainless steel 304 for critical components. Many machines offer modular designs for easy maintenance, with quick-access panels for cleaning or part replacement. Noise levels are typically kept below 65 dB, making them suitable for indoor installation near workspaces.

Application Areas

In the food industry, flake ice machines are indispensable for preserving perishables like seafood, poultry, and vegetables during processing or display. The ice's soft texture prevents damage to delicate products while maintaining consistent low temperatures. Supermarkets and fisheries use them for fresh seafood showcases. Beyond food, these machines serve concrete plants by cooling mixing water in hot climates to prevent premature curing. Chemical and pharmaceutical industries utilize flake ice for temperature control in reactors and transportation of heat-sensitive materials. Some medical facilities employ them for therapeutic cooling applications.

Maintenance and Precautions

Regular maintenance is crucial for optimal performance. Monthly tasks include cleaning the water distribution system to prevent mineral buildup and inspecting the blade for wear. The condenser should be checked quarterly for dust accumulation, which can reduce efficiency by up to 20%. Water quality significantly impacts operation. Total dissolved solids (TDS) should remain below 250 ppm to minimize scaling. Installing a water softener or reverse osmosis system is recommended in areas with hard water. Proper ventilation around the machine prevents overheating, with ambient temperatures ideally below 35°C (95°F).

B2B Procurement Guide

When sourcing flake ice machines, prioritize suppliers with ISO 9001 certification and a proven track record in industrial refrigeration. Request energy efficiency data and compare the IPLV (Integrated Part Load Value) across models. Leading manufacturers often provide 1–2 years of comprehensive warranty. Consider total cost of ownership, not just the purchase price. Energy-efficient models may have higher upfront costs but offer significant savings in operational expenses. For large-scale operations, modular systems allow capacity expansion as needed. Verify that the supplier stocks spare parts locally to minimize downtime during repairs.
